Sustainable Decor: The New Standard in Modern Tiny Homes

Eco-friendly materials and designs redefine luxury in compact living spaces

Eco-conscious design has transitioned from a niche preference to the forefront of modern aesthetics.

 

Recent trends indicate a significant surge in the use of sustainable materials such as reclaimed wood, bamboo, and low-VOC finishes in home decor.

 

This shift reflects a growing desire for homes that not only look appealing but also embody environmental responsibility.

 

Incorporating elements like reclaimed oak tables and lime-wash walls, homeowners are embracing designs that are both stylish and sustainable.

 

For tiny homes, this approach is more than a trend—it's a guiding principle.

 

Imagine a 300-square-foot dwelling constructed entirely from eco-friendly materials: cork walls that naturally regulate temperature, FSC-certified wood cabinetry, and salvaged hardwood floors rich with history.

 

Features like solar-ready roofs and non-toxic finishes elevate compact living to a form of eco-luxury that is both sophisticated and responsible.

 

In a world that values authenticity, sustainability offers more than just cost savings—it provides depth and meaning.

 

Tiny homes built with a conscience demonstrate that true luxury is measured not by size, but by the impact we leave on the planet.
